Which Marvel heroes have kids?

The children are James Rogers, the son of Black Widow and Captain America; Henry Pym Jr., the son of Giant-Man and Wasp; Azari, the son of Black Panther and Storm; and Torunn, the daughter of the absent Thor and Sif.

How old is Sofia strange?

The first issue of Strange Magic is called “New Sheriff in Town”. We meet Sofia, a fifteen year old Sorceress who just moved to New Orleans, Louisiana. She’s moved from city to city her whole life as Sofia’s guardian, Vesper, always moved them to another city whenever she would catch Sofia using magic.

Do superheroes have a positive impact on children?

For example, almost one third of participating parents said they thought that superheroes had a positive influence on their children, with the majority of those parents mentioning how superheroes serve as “positive role models” by engaging in defending behavior.

Do superheroes make kids aggressive and prosocial?

The main focus of the study was to examine the impact of children’s superhero engagement on their subsequent aggressive and prosocial behavior. The authors found that kids who had greater superhero engagement at the beginning of the study were more likely to exhibit both physical and aggressive behavior a year later.
